Nestled in the heart of the Champagne region, in the picturesque village of Tours-sur-Marne, lies the Lamiable family's champagne house. For three generations, they have passionately crafted unique and elegant champagnes. The story began in 1955 when Pierre Lamiable and his brothers planted their first vines in the vineyard called Les Vignes des Meslaines. Their ambition soon led to the purchase of their own wine press and tanks, which allowed them to produce their first bottles of champagne.
